ui: use task state to determine if task is active (#14224)
Browse files Browse the repository at this point in the history
The current implementation uses the task's finishedAt field to determine
if a task is active of not, but this check is not accurate. A task in
the "pending" state will not have finishedAt value but it's also not
active.

This discrepancy results in some components, like the inline stats chart
of the task row component, to be displayed even whey they shouldn't.
